Latest Patents

Anderson holds a patent for a microfibrous sorbent article, which features an elongate boom with a substantially oval cross-section. This boom is constructed from multiple adjacent microfiber layers that are bonded together through the entanglement of fibers between the layers. The patent outlines not only the design of the sorbent article but also a method for its production, showcasing Anderson's expertise in material engineering.
